以太坊自2015年推出以来,已成为全球最大的去中心化平台之一,其引入的智能合约技术,为加密货币以及各种去中心化应用提供了基础。钱包合约作为以太坊的一种重要应用,能够帮助用户更高效、安全地管理数字资产。本文旨在深入探讨以太坊钱包合约,包括其基本概念、种类、使用方法以及未来发展趋势,帮助大众用户理解并有效使用这一工具。
### 以太坊钱包合约的基础知识钱包合约是以智能合约为基础的一种数字钱包,它不仅可以存储加密货币,还能执行复杂的交易和资金管理。例如,用户可以设定条件,只有满足这些条件时,资金才能被转移。
相较于传统的钱包(如硬件钱包和软件钱包),钱包合约具有更高的自动化程度和灵活性。用户可以通过编程实现特定的资金管理功能,而传统钱包则更多依赖用户手动操作。
钱包合约工作在以太坊区块链之上,用户在合约中设定相关的资产持有和转移规则,合约会根据预设的条件自动执行。比如,当用户设置了多签名条件后,只有大多数相关方同意之后,资金才能被转出。
### 以太坊钱包合约的类型热钱包是指在线钱包,适合频繁交易但安全性相对较低;而冷钱包则是离线存储,安全性高,适合长期持有数字资产。
自托管钱包由用户自己掌控密钥,提升了安全性;第三方钱包则提供便捷性,但需信任服务提供商的安全性。
多签钱包合约要求多个签名才能进行交易,这有助于防止单一方的恶意操作,特别适合组织或团队管理资金。
### 钱包合约的安全性钱包合约可能面临黑客攻击、合约漏洞以及用户私钥泄露等安全风险,用户需要充分了解并采取措施保护自身资产。
确保钱包合约安全的措施包括使用强密码、启用双重认证、定期进行合约审计等。
合约审计能发现潜在漏洞、提高合约的安全性,是确保用户资产安全的重要步骤。
### 如何使用以太坊钱包合约用户可以通过各种以太坊钱包提供的界面,按照指导创建并配置钱包合约,包括设定合约的各种参数。
用户可以根据合约设定的条件进行资金的转账和接收,合约会自动执行相关操作。
以某个多签钱包合约为例,只有当多个签名者同意后,资金才会被转移,这样避免了单方操作带来的风险。
### 以太坊钱包合约的潜在用例用户可以利用钱包合约管理各种代币,实现自动化管理和交易。
钱包合约在DeFi中扮演重要角色,用户可以借助合约实现借贷、收益 farming 等操作。
用户可以通过钱包合约管理自己的NFT资产,实现自动转让、展示等功能。
### 如何选择合适的以太坊钱包合约在选择钱包合约时,用户应该根据自己的需求比较不同合约的特性与功能,包括安全性、易用性等。
参考用户评价和市场信誉,有助于挑选出安全可靠的钱包合约。
用户在使用钱包合约时应注意备份私钥、谨慎选择合约参数等,防止潜在的资产损失。
### 未来发展与展望随着区块链技术的不断发展,以太坊生态系统也在与时俱进,钱包合约的应用场景将不断丰富。
未来钱包合约可能会出现更多智能化的管理工具,简化用户操作,也将推向更多行业。
以太坊的升级与新协议的推出,将为钱包合约带来更多可能性,增强其功能与应用。
### 结论以太坊钱包合约不仅提升了数字资产的管理效率与安全性,也是以太坊生态中不可或缺的重要一环。鼓励广大用户深入了解与使用钱包合约,以便在加密货币世界中更好地保护和管理自身资产。
## 七个相关问题 1. **什么是以太坊钱包合约的工作机制?** 2. **用户如何避免在使用钱包合约时的常见错误?** 3. **如何审计以太坊钱包合约以提高安全性?** 4. **在什么情况下应选择多签名钱包合约?** 5. **以太坊钱包合约对金额限制有何影响?** 6. **如何实现以太坊钱包合约的自动化管理功能?** 7. **钱包合约与去中心化金融之间的关系是什么?** ### 问题 1: 什么是以太坊钱包合约的工作机制?以太坊钱包合约的核心机制是智能合约。智能合约是编写在以太坊区块链上的自执行合约,能够自动地根据预设的条件执行操作。
钱包合约通常包括以下几个关键要素:
合约通常会设定条件,例如资金转移必须得到特定人数的签名,只有在这些条件满足时,资金才能进行转移。这样,钱包合约不仅保护了用户的资产,还提高了资金管理的灵活性。
### 问题 2: 用户如何避免在使用钱包合约时的常见错误?用户在使用以太坊钱包合约时容易犯错误,了解并这些行为至关重要。
首先,用户应确保清楚自己的资金管理需求及合约的实际功能。例如,过于复杂的合约设置可能导致不必要的麻烦,尤其是在资金转移方面。用户可以简单设置合约,并经常进行测试。
其次,私钥的管理非常重要。许多用户在管理私钥时可能会不小心将其泄露,因此应确保私钥的安全存储,不在互联网上分享。
另外,用户在与合约交互时,务必仔细阅读合约的功能说明与条款,确保合约的功能符合自己的需求,避免因盲目操作而产生不必要的损失。
最后,使用高度信任且经过审计的合约,避免使用不熟悉的合约。用户可以参考他人的评价和使用经验,谨慎选择合约。
### 问题 3: 如何审计以太坊钱包合约以提高安全性?合约审计旨在检测钱包合约中的漏洞与缺陷,提升合约的安全性。审计通常包括代码审查、漏洞扫描和安全性测试等多个环节。
首先,专业的合约审计团队会对合约代码进行全面审查,识别潜在的安全风险。审计过程中,团队会关注常见的漏洞,如重入攻击、整数溢出等。
其次,团队会进行安全性测试,通过模拟各种攻击手段,评估合约在不同情况下的表现。这可以验证合约是否能在敌对环境中正常工作。
审计完成后,团队通常会提供一份全文报告,帮助开发者理解潜在风险及推荐改进措施。用户在选择合约时,应该优先考虑那些经过知名团队审计的合约,降低交易风险。
### 问题 4: 在什么情况下应选择多签名钱包合约?多签名钱包合约允许多个授权方共同管理一个资金账户,虽然提供了更高的安全保障,但也增加了操作复杂性。其优势在于:
首先,防止单一信息泄露。当资金管理决策涉及多方时,即便某一方的私钥被破解,只有在获得其余方同意的前提下,资金才能被转移,从而大大降低资产风险。
其次,多签名功能增强了合约的民主性,特别适用于团队或组织,共同管理项目资金,避免单一决策的潜在风险。
当涉及高额资金、大额交易时,选用多签名钱包合约将有助于提升安全性和透明度,确保资金流动的合规与安全。适用于企业、DAO(去中心化自治组织)等需要多人共同决策的场景。
### 问题 5: 以太坊钱包合约对金额限制有何影响?以太坊钱包合约本身不会对转账金额进行限制,但是一些因素会间接影响交易的金额上限。
首先,用户自行设定的合约规则可能包含交易金额限制,用于控制资金交易的上限,保障资金安全。在合约设计阶段,用户应根据自身资金量以及利用场景合理设计这些限制。
其次,以太坊网络的Gas费用也会对交易金额产生影响。在网络繁忙时,Gas费用上涨可能导致低额转账变得不划算,因此用户应考虑Gas费用的影响,选定合适的转账金额。
最后,一些第三方服务提供者(如去中心化交易所)可能设置对较小金额的交易进行限制,以保证交易目的的有效性与流动性,因此在使用这些服务时需要留意相关规定。
### 问题 6: 如何实现以太坊钱包合约的自动化管理功能?以太坊钱包合约的自动化管理功能可通过编码实现。合约功能的编写应当兼顾用户目标与安全隐患:
首先,用户需要明确自动化管理的目标,例如资金自动转入、出账规则、条件限制等。在设计合约时,将这些功能一一嵌入代码,通过函数调用实现自动执行。
其次,通过触发条件实现自动执行,例如设定定时转账,或者满足特定条件后自动转账。借助块链网络定期更新状态,以及不断监测外部数据源,可以实现这种动态管理。
最后,用户可通过调用API或第三方工具,对合约进行周期性管理与监控,确保合约在无人操作的情况下依然可以正常运行。
### 问题 7: 钱包合约与去中心化金融之间的关系是什么?去中心化金融(DeFi)是一种依托于区块链技术的金融系统,其革命性体现在不需要中央金融机构,就可实现金融服务,而钱包合约则是DeFi的核心组成部分之一。
首先,钱包合约为DeFi提供了资金管理的基本单元,使用户可以安全、便捷地存储、转移和处理资产。而智能合约则将这一过程自动化,提高了透明度与安全性。
其次,通过钱包合约,用户能够参与到各种DeFi应用中,包括借贷、流动性挖掘等金融服务。钱包合约可以自动执行这些金融产品的合约条款,无需中心化中介,为用户提供更高效的金融体验。
最后,钱包合约的安全性直接影响DeFi市场的稳定。随着DeFi生态的扩大,钱包合约的漏洞或错误可能导致资产大规模流失,因此确保钱包合约的安全至关重要。
以上内容为以太坊钱包合约的全面概览,探讨了其各个方面以及用户可能面临的问题和解决方案。希望能够帮助用户更好地了解钱包合约并在实际操作中更加谨慎。